I got a good response with people pointing me to both sides.</p>
<p>For me the question remained unanswered until now.</p>
<h4>Bye Bye Gallery 2</h4>
<p>A month ago, I knocked off my photo album which was powered by Gallery 2. Gallery 2 is an amazing software, but I didn&#8217;t have the time to actually maintain yet another site. I wanted to have a solution where I let someone else do the dirty work of running the gallery.</p>
<h4>Yahoo! Photos?</h4>
<p>Since knocking it off I&#8217;ve considered two options, the first was <a href="http://photos.yahoo.com/">Yahoo! Photos</a>. I love the interface of the new Photos beta. I&#8217;ve got my Dad to host his pictures out there. The in-browser tool works perfectly in Firefox, IE and Flock.</p>
<h4>Picasaweb?</h4>
<p>About a week back I started using <a href="http://picasaweb.google.com/">Picasaweb</a> after the <a href="http://techtites.com/2007/03/11/more-from-picasa-web-albums/">storage for free users was increased to 1GB</a>.</p>
<p>Picasaweb is good. The software is well featured, however I faced a big problem uploading photos. It could very well be my connection, since I haven&#8217;t seen reports of it elsewhere.</p>
<p><span id="more-1046"></span></p>
<h4>No it&#8217;s Flickr Pro</h4>
<p>The turning point to Flickr came yesterday when <a href="http://techtites.com/2007/03/15/flickr-introduces-collections-only-for-pro-users/">Flickr introduced Collections</a>.</p>
<p>Honestly, the only reason I was reluctant to use Flickr was the inability to create sub-albums. Yes I know in Web 2.0, we use tags, but I like things of Web 1.0 like sub-folders and sub-albums!</p>
<p>Now, you can put several sets into a single collection upto five levels deep (I need to figure out the sub-levels).</p>
<p>I picked up a two year Flickr Pro account yesterday and have immediately started the tedious work of uploading my photos. <p>But to keep myself up-to-date required me to daily go through almost a hundred websites (and steadily increasing).</p>
<p>This inspired me to start a blog that will get the choicest of technology news all in one central location.</p>
<p>Hence, 30th October 2006 saw the launch of my technology blog titled <a href="http://techtites.com/">Techtites</a>.</p>
<p><strong>Why Techtites?</strong></p>
<p>Since the central theme of the blog is technology, for the purpose of <acronym title="Search Engine Optimization">SEO</acronym> I wanted the domain to contain the word &#8220;tech&#8221;. Unfortunately, almost every technology name I could think of was taken.</p>
<p>Until my astronomy pal suggested the name Techtites, which is a play on the word <a href="http://www.answers.com/Tektite">Tektite</a>.</p>
<p><img src="http://ajaydsouza.com/wp-content/uploads/Tektite.jpg" width="163" height="150" alt="A Tektite" title="A Tektite" /></p>
<blockquote><p>Any of numerous generally small, rounded, dark brown to green glassy objects that are composed of silicate glass and are thought to have been formed by the impact of a meteorite with the earth&#8217;s surface.</p></blockquote>
<p>Tektites are considered to be of great value and I hope that Techtites will also be of the same value to you.</p>
